The Schrödinger equation for a general system is
- <math>-\frac{\hbar^2}{2\mu}\nabla^2\Psi - V\Psi = E\Psi</math>
where <math>\mu</math> is the mass.
For a hydrogen atom, the potential energy <math>V</math> is
- <math>V = -\frac{e^2}{4 \pi \epsilon_0 r}</math>
i.e. <math>V</math> is a function of the radial distance <math>r</math> only: <math>V = V(r)</math>
By performing a co-ordinate transformation from Cartesian to spherical polars:
- <math>x = r\,\sin\theta\,\cos\varphi</math>
- <math>y = r\,\sin\theta\,\sin\varphi</math>
- <math>z = r\,\cos\theta</math>
